Output 3febc6bb789e973621c1a058e51fc12daf3f91b2724d08cb53fa52c5b8b97ea0:65

value
42127
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9beb04829767c61670bcd26e8781b0e828e0b784 OP_EQUALVERIFY OP_CHECKSIG
address
1FDRH3ZE988LRKryobAALYmSb1fK1gmhyx
transaction
3febc6bb789e973621c1a058e51fc12daf3f91b2724d08cb53fa52c5b8b97ea0
confirmations
18401
spent
true